Mountain Home, Arkansas vs. Rogers, Arkansas

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Rogers, Arkansas is 21.8% more expensive than Mountain Home, Arkansas.

You would need a salary of $60,919 in Rogers, Arkansas to maintain the standard of living you have in Mountain Home, Arkansas.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Rogers, Arkansas is more expensive than Mountain Home, Arkansas
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
60% more expensive in Rogers
than in Mountain Home, Arkansas
